Born out of the Blues Brothers inspired soul revival of the mid eighties, the band have been going strong for over 25 years. Performing over a thousand gigs in pubs, clubs and parties all over the UK and Europe, they play classic soul hits such as 'Soul Man', 'Mustang Sally' and 'Midnight Hour' mixed with current dance floor fillers like Amy Winehouse's 'Valerie' and Pharrell Williams' 'Happy'.
